Physicians Formula Argan Wear Ultra-Nourishing Argan Oil Kohl Kajal Eyeliner Review

There is a tassel! A Tassel! Have you ever seen an eyeliner with a tassel before?

I haven't, and that is why I bought this Argan Wear Ultra-Nourishing Argan Oil Kohl Kajal Eyeliner even though I have never enjoyed Physicians Formula Kohl Kajal Eyeliners in the past. I have bought two sets of trios from their Shimmer Strips line, and they were not lasting and they smudged as if it was pouring out that day. But this liner is from their Argan Wear line, so I figured the formula  would be different.


And boy was it different!


Even the texture is different! The usual kohl liners I have used were always slick and silky. They glided on beautifully, but because of their soft, slippery texture, they do not stay in place for very long. The Argan Wear Argan Oil Kohl Kajal Liner on the other hand has a thick, creamy texture. It still is easy to apply, but it didn't glide like its cousins, so this liner actually stays put, all day long! It did smudge on me at the end of the day, but no where near as bad as the other ones.

The Kohl liner is also jet black. Because of it's original pointed shape, it was easy for me to create a simple winged line. However, I have a feeling that that the point is not going to keep that shape as I use it more. This liner also has more product inside the packaging where you twist up to get to the rest of the liner out, unlike the other kohl liners where all you see is all you get. 
This liner is also infused with 100% Argan Oil, which is a Moroccan ingredient known to have many skin benefit. So I am thinking this will be good for the lashes. 

So you can say that I really enjoy this Argan Oil Liner. Not only is the packaging beautiful, but Physicians Formula did a great job with the formula.
